This documentation describes how to proceed with the reinstallation of a STARFACE appliance. The steps to be performed one after the other are:
- Create a bootable USB stick for reinstallation
- Configuring New Backup and back it up outside the appliance
- Connect the USB stick to the appliance and start the system from the USB stick
- After successful installation unplug the USB stick and restart the system
- In the initial configuration, the backup can now be imported directly
- Adjust network settings
- Restore the server license and have it confirmed by STARFACE

Note to Enterprise v5
If an Enterprise v5 is not automatically booted from the USB stick for a new installation, press the <F7> key to call up the boot menu and manually select the USB stick. The reinstallation of Enterprise v5 can then be started via the following item in the boot menu:
Install new system (Enterprise v5 / Platinum v5)
Note to the LED Status
The current status of the installation can be checked on appliances without monitor output on the status LED on the front panel.
1. LED is permanently red
Duration: approx. 30-60 seconds
Meaning: System starts
2. LED flashes red
Duration: approx. 60 minutes (depending on the speed of the USB stick and the version to be installed)
Meaning: New system is being installed
3. LED is permanently red
Duration: infinite
Meaning: Installation is complete. The USB stick can be removed and the system can be switched off by a long press of the power button.
After restarting the system without an USB stick, an orange LED indicates the ready state and access to the web interface is possible.
Note to the BIOS Update
If the following error message causes the installation process to abort during installation, a BIOS update must be performed:
"Trying to unpack rootfs as initramfs....."
Note On the Update From Version 5.3
A STARFACE appliance with version 5.3 must be reinstalled to get to one of the higher versions. This is due to extensive updates of the underlying software. It should also be noted that the following two appliance types are only supported up to version 5.3:
- STARFACE Small Business
- STARFACE Professional
